    A few days ago, just in case anyone doesn't know, or hasn't gotten the notification to update. I - and lots of others, it seems - had an issue whereby the update froze after a few minutes, but if you do a hard reset after a few mins it should restart with 7.1.2 installed.

  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 682 ✭✭✭Xantia


    I updated it because of the constant polling and losing of wifi (logs on the router), it has fixed that anyway.
    (I think that was the main reason for the update)
